Title: National Coral Reef Monitoring Program: Carbonate Budget data of the Flower Garden Banks National Marine Sanctuary from 2015-06-01 to 2015-06-05 (NCEI Accession 0159174)
Abstract: This dataset includes census based carbonate budget data that was collected in coral reef habitats located within the Flower Garden Banks National Marine Sanctuary (FGBNMS). Surveys (based on Perry et al 2012) were collected over one week aboard R/V Manta at the East Flower Garden Bank Mooring Buoy 3. Six transect surveys (10m each) were conducted to quantify benthic cover, macrobioerosion, and microbioerosion. Ten parrotfish surveys were also conducted to account for parrotfish erosion rates. This carbonate budget data along with other sea water chemistry data collected were used to establish a Class III monitoring site in the FGBNMS region.
